Scan barcode
276 pages • first pub 2006 (editions)
ISBN/UID: 9781840244854
Format: Digital
Language: English
Publisher: Summersdale Publishers
Publication date: 01 February 2006
276 pages • first pub 2006 (editions)
ISBN/UID: 9781840244854
Format: Digital
Language: English
Publisher: Summersdale Publishers
Publication date: 01 February 2006
276 pages • first pub 2006 (editions)
ISBN/UID: 9781567318258
Format: Hardcover
Language: English
Publisher: MJF Books
Publication date: Not specified
276 pages • first pub 2006 (editions)
ISBN/UID: 9781567318258
Format: Hardcover
Language: English
Publisher: MJF Books
Publication date: Not specified
276 pages • first pub 2006 (editions)
ISBN/UID: 9781862547223
Format: Paperback
Language: Indonesian
Publisher: Wakefield Press
Publication date: Not specified
276 pages • first pub 2006 (editions)
ISBN/UID: 9781862547223
Format: Paperback
Language: Indonesian
Publisher: Wakefield Press
Publication date: Not specified